RetroForth on DexOS
« on: April 30, 2007, 12:33:20 AM »

I've tried running RetroForth on DexOS but there are some problems.  The cursor, for example appears some 4 lines above where the text you type actually appears which means when the cursor is near the bottom of the screen you can't see what you type until it scrolls up.  Also, when I try to enter a " (double quote) I get an @ and a few spaces instead.

I asked on the DexOS forums and they said that there is an offset for DexOS for where the text appears and thought it would be an easy fix (see the DexOS General forum, search for 'RetroForth').  Not sure about the " thing, though.

Any help appreciated!

Re: RetroForth on DexOS
« Reply #1 on: April 30, 2007, 12:54:26 PM »

I'm no longer using DexOS or working on the RetroForth/4u port. (The entire DexOS project lacks a real direction, and the lack of design consistency in the syscalls provided makes it a pain to keep working at all)

The source code can be found at http://retroforth.org/download/8.2.5/rf8-dex4u.zip - perhaps Dex or one of the other developers there can help fix the bugs. If so, I'm open to updating the copy on this site.

Beyond this, I have no idea what changed in DexOS to make the cursor/text positioning break since I last updated this port, and the " issue is likely due to a non-standard keymap.
